  • Gerald, Missouri Census Data
  • The total number of people in Gerald is 3,184. Of those, 1,637 are Male (51.41 %) and 1,547 are Female (48.59 %).

    In Gerald, Missouri 38.9 is the median age.

    Gerald, Missouri population is broken down (as a percentage) by age as follows:

    Under Age of 5: 5.18 %
    Ages 5 to 9: 6.91 %
    Ages 10 to 14: 8.29 %
    Ages 15 to 19: 7.44 %
    Ages 20 to 24: 4.49 %
    Ages 25 to 34: 11.18 %
    Ages 35 to 44: 17.18 %
    Ages 45 to 54: 13.16 %
    Ages 55 to 59: 5.65 %
    Ages 60 to 64: 4.93 %
    Ages 65 to 74: 8.73 %
    Ages 75 to 84: 5.09 %
    Over the age of 85: 1.76 %

    Analysis of Education/Enrollment in Gerald, Missouri:
    A total of 821 people over the age of three are enrolled in school in Gerald.
    Of the total enrolled in Gerald:
    24 children in Gerald are enrolled in Nursery School.
    32 children are attending Kindergarten in Gerald.
    460 children in Gerald attend Primary School
    232 young people in Gerald attend Secondary School.
    73 people are enrolled in college in Gerald.
    789 people have a High School diploma (or equivalent).
    468 people have attended some college (without a degree).
    146 people in Gerald have an Associates Degree.
    133 people in Gerald have a Bachelors Degree.
    28 people in Gerald have a Graduate Degree.

    Gerald Statistical Data
    Gerald, Missouri Total Area covers 81.91 Square Miles.
    Total Water Area is 0.17 Square Miles.
    Total Land Area is 81.74 Square Miles.
    In Gerald, MO. pop. density is 38.95 persons/square mile.
    Gerald, Missouri is located in the Central (GMT -6) Time Zone.
    The elevation in Gerald is 545 Ft.

    Economic Data for Gerald, MO.

    Family Income Data for Gerald:
    Income per household breakdown is as follows:
    Earning under $10,000 annually: 106
    Earning $10,000.00 to $14,999 annually: 78
    Earning $15,000 to $24,999 annually: 165
    Earning $25,000 to $34,999 annually: 147
    Earning $35,000 to $49,999 annually: 223
    Earning $50,000 to $74,999 annually: 243
    Earning $75,000 to $99,999 annually: 88
    Earning $100,000 to $149,999 annually: 87
    Earning $150,000 to $199,999 annually: 17
    Earning $200,000 or more annually: 14
    $40,519.00 is the Median Annual Income per family in Gerald.

    Employment Data:
    1,646 are employed in Gerald, Missouri.
    65 are unemployed in Gerald.
    Of those that currently employed in Gerald:
    893 Males are currently employed in Gerald.
    753 Females are currently employed in Gerald, MO.

Tapering off drug or alcohol use can help somewhat to reduce withdrawal symptoms, but for many individuals, particularly those that abuse highly addictive drugs for an extended period of time, it simply may not be achievable to do that. The drug addiction or alcoholism can simply have advanced too far and the impulse to use a drug or alcohol has grown to be too powerful. In such circumstances, an alcohol or drug detoxification facility is the safest route to handling the withdrawal process. Most drug treatment and alcohol rehab programs offer a medical detox to minimize withdrawal symptoms that are caused by the sudden discontinuation of addictive drugs or alcohol so that the sometimes uncomfortable withdrawal process can be made more pleasant for the patient. Stopping the use of addictive drugs and alcohol using the cold turkey approach is not advised mainly because it can occasionally cause life-threatening withdrawal symptoms, such as seizures.

Some of the signs and symptoms of drug addiction or alcoholism consist of inadequate school or employment attendance and performance, unkempt hygiene and appearance, changes in eating habits, unusual sleeping habits, isolating from friends and family, missing work or school, money troubles, anger and hostility toward family, withdrawal symptoms when the drug or alcohol is not obtainable, cravings and the need to acquire the drug or alcohol despite the consequences including but not limited to lying and stealing to get it.
